Reserve seemed well maintained, bathroom facilities at the entrance was clean. Gates were open early, but the office only opened later, opted to hike early, and paid on the way out. Cost for day was R70 per person. Reception was a few snacks for sale, and reasonably priced. Drive to reserve is along a length gravel road, most of which is well maintained. Last about 1.5km has a few rough patches. Multiple hikes start from here.

Stunning scenery and a few hikes ranging in difficulty. The staff at the reception are very friendly and the ablutions at the reception area are in the good condition however the same cannot be said about the rest of the facilities. The day visitors area is a mess with long grass and dilapidated facilities. The trails are not well marked and are badly overgrown in areas, the place on the whole seems somewhat forgotten.

The short hike to the waterfall is beautiful and definitely recommended. Great for swimming and the views are lovely. We struggled with the drive (it had rained a bit and the dirt road is terrible). Also struggled paying as they only accept cash (R70 per adult). The staff were friendly but the hiking map is not very clear and the trails not very well marked.
